科讯CMS数据库是科讯CMS系统的重要组成部分,主要负责存储和管理CMS系统中的各种数据。它包括用户信息、内容信息、系统设置等各类数据。数据库的设计和管理直接影响到整个CMS系统的性能和稳定性。数据库的主要功能包括数据存储、数据管理和数据查询。 其中,数据存储是数据库最基础的功能,包括数据的添加、删除和修改。数据管理则包括数据的备份、恢复、优化等功能,以确保数据的安全和完整。数据查询则是数据库的主要功能之一,通过SQL语言,可以快速精确地查找到需要的数据。
I. 数据库的存储功能
科讯CMS数据库的存储功能,简单来说,就是将CMS系统中的各种数据存储在数据库中。这些数据包括用户信息、内容信息、系统设置等。这些数据是CMS系统运行的基础,没有这些数据,CMS系统就无法正常运行。
用户信息主要包括用户的用户名、密码、邮箱等。这些信息是用户登录系统和接收系统通知的基础。内容信息则包括文章的标题、内容、作者、发布时间等。这些信息是构成网站内容的基础。系统设置则包括网站的标题、描述、关键字等,这些信息是优化搜索引擎排名的重要因素。
II. 数据库的管理功能
科讯CMS数据库的管理功能,主要包括数据的备份、恢复、优化等。这些功能都是为了确保数据的安全和完整。
数据备份是将数据库中的数据复制一份存储在其他地方,以防数据丢失。数据恢复则是在数据丢失后,通过备份数据将丢失的数据恢复回来。数据优化则是通过一些手段提高数据库的性能,比如删除无用的数据、合理设计数据库结构等。
III. 数据库的查询功能
科讯CMS数据库的查询功能是数据库的主要功能之一,通过SQL语言,可以快速精确地查找到需要的数据。
SQL是结构化查询语言,是操作数据库的标准语言。通过SQL,可以对数据库中的数据进行增加、删除、修改、查询等操作。比如,可以通过SQL查询到所有的用户信息,或者查询到所有的文章信息,或者查询到特定的系统设置信息。
在科讯CMS系统中,数据库查询的功能非常重要。比如,当用户登录系统时,系统需要查询数据库中的用户信息来验证用户的身份。当用户浏览网站时,系统需要查询数据库中的文章信息来展示给用户。当搜索引擎爬取网站时,系统需要查询数据库中的系统设置信息来提供给搜索引擎。
IV. 数据库的重要性
科讯CMS数据库对于整个CMS系统来说极其重要。它不仅负责存储系统中的各种数据,也负责管理这些数据,以确保数据的安全和完整。同时,它还提供了数据查询的功能,使得系统能够快速精确地获取到需要的数据。因此,数据库的设计和管理对于整个CMS系统的性能和稳定性有着直接的影响。
相关问答FAQs:
1. 什么是科讯CMS数据库?
科讯CMS数据库是科讯CMS(Content Management System)系统所使用的数据库。科讯CMS是一种用于构建和管理网站的内容管理系统,它的数据库用于存储和管理网站的各种内容,包括文章、图片、视频、用户信息等。科讯CMS数据库采用关系型数据库的结构,通过表格的方式将数据存储起来,以便于网站管理员和用户进行访问和管理。
2. 科讯CMS数据库有什么功能?
科讯CMS数据库具有以下几个主要功能:
-
存储网站内容:科讯CMS数据库用于存储网站的各种内容,包括文章、图片、视频等。管理员可以通过数据库管理工具对这些内容进行增删改查操作。
-
管理用户信息:科讯CMS数据库还用于存储和管理用户的注册信息、登录信息、权限等。通过数据库,管理员可以对用户进行管理,例如创建新用户、修改用户信息、删除用户等。
-
提供数据接口:科讯CMS数据库为网站提供了数据接口,使得网站的前端页面可以通过调用接口获取数据库中的内容,并将其展示给用户。这样,网站的内容可以动态更新,而不需要手动修改网页代码。
-
数据备份和恢复:科讯CMS数据库还具备数据备份和恢复的功能,管理员可以定期对数据库进行备份,以防止数据丢失或损坏。当数据库发生故障或数据丢失时,管理员可以通过备份文件将数据库恢复到之前的状态。
3. 如何优化科讯CMS数据库的性能?
要优化科讯CMS数据库的性能,可以采取以下几个措施:
-
索引优化:为数据库中的关键字段创建索引,可以加快查询速度。但需要注意的是,过多的索引会增加数据库的存储空间和写入性能,因此需要根据具体情况进行权衡。
-
数据库缓存:使用数据库缓存可以减少对数据库的访问次数,提高网站的响应速度。可以使用缓存插件或者将常用的数据存储在缓存服务器中。
-
数据库分区:对于数据量较大的表,可以考虑将其进行分区,将数据分散存储在多个磁盘上,以提高查询和写入性能。
-
数据库优化:定期对数据库进行优化,包括清理无用数据、压缩数据库、优化查询语句等,以提高数据库的性能和稳定性。
-
服务器优化:优化服务器的配置和性能,包括增加内存、调整数据库参数、优化网络设置等,可以提升数据库的运行效率。
通过以上措施,可以有效地提升科讯CMS数据库的性能,使网站能够更快地响应用户请求,并提供更好的用户体验。
文章标题:科讯cms数据库是什么,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/2831285